  • proposed by Baddeley and Hitch (1974) which focuses on short-term memory and was a response to STM being oversiplified in MSM

  • the components of the WMM are:
    • central executive
    • phonological loop
    • visuo-spatial sketchpad
    • episodic buffer
  • the central executive controls the WMM, makes the decisions so all info passes through it and gives allocated task to the other three slave systems
    • other components can only communicate via the CE, NOT directly
    • modality free = can process info from any senses
  • The phonological loop is responsible for processing auditory information and has two subcomponents: the articulatory process and the phonological store
    • CAPACITY = 2 seconds
    • ENCODES = acoustically
  • Visuo-Spatial Sketchpad processes visual/spatial information and has two subcomponents: the visuo cache and the inner scribe
    • CAPACITY = 3/4 objects or blocks
    • ENCODE = visually
  • Episodic Buffer - integrates information from different sources into one coherent representation and links new information with existing knowledgemaintains sense of time sequencing and also links to LTM and wider cognitive process [e.g perception]
    • modality free
    • CAPACITY = 4 chunks
